Quantum Materials Design and Growth Laboratory

Picture
Heterostructure Transfer System Setup for Moiré Quantum Matter Research
Following Equipment to Setup in the Quantum Materials Growth Laboratory:
  1. Heterostructure Transfer System for Design of Moiré Quantum Materials
  2. Vacuum Furnace System for Graphene Growth
  3. Vacuum Furnace System for Hexagonal Boron Nitride Growth
  4. Vacuum Furnace System for Transition Metal Dichalcogenides Growth
  5. Growth Facilities for 1D Materials: Silicon Nanowire, Zinc Oxide and CNTs 
  6. Solution Processed Growth of Large-scale Quantum Materials

Photophysics Characterization Laboratory

Picture
Photophysics Characterization Laboratory (Under Renovation)
Following Equipment to Setup in the Photophysics Characterization Laboratory:
  1. ​Confocal Raman and Photoluminescence Spectrometer
  2. Photocurrent Imaging Spectroscopy Setup
  3. Antibunching: Photon Emission Correlation Spectroscopy Facility
  4. Time Correlated Single Photon Counting Facility with Lifetime Imaging and Time-Resolved Luminescence Microscopy
  5. Low-Temperature Electrical and Optical Transport Characterization Setup
